What is international staffing approach?
The ethnocentric staffing policy refers to the strategy of a multinational company to employ managers for key positions from the parent headquarters instead of employing local staff (“Global Human Resource Management”). Effective communication between headquarters and the subsidiary.
What is international staffing outline the nature of international staffing?
INTERNATIONAL STAFFING The decision of international staffing in MNC depends on following factors: General staffing policy on key positions in HQ and subsidiary. The ability of organization to attract the right candidate. The constraints placed by the host government on hiring policies. 2INTERNATIONAL STAFFING.
What is international staffing Slideshare?
International Managers • An expatriate is an employee who works and reside in a foreign country • Expatriate managers are mainly of two types • PCNs (Parent country nationals) • A national of a country of MNC’s headquarters • TCNs (Third country nationals) • A national of a country other than the MNCs home country or …

What is a staffing approach?
Staffing is the process of hiring employees to fill the vacant positions in an organization. There are various techniques and methods used by organizations to hire the right candidate for a position. MNE uses three approaches in staffing viz. Ethnocentric, Polycentric and Geocentric.
Why is international staffing important?
International staffing is a necessary piece to your global expansion puzzle. Moving into a new market requires hiring local employees or contractors to assist effectively and efficiently with growth. For example, hiring an in-country sales representative boosts sales because that rep understands the market and culture.

What are the selection criteria for international staffing?
Selection criteria for International Staffing International selection is a two way process between the individual and the organization. A prospective candidate may reject the expatriate assignment either for personal reasons, such as family considerations, or for situational factors.
